【问题标题】:jQuery UI - which CSS to include?jQuery UI - 要包含哪些 CSS?
【发布时间】:2016-04-24 11:28:45
【问题描述】:

jQuery UI 的文档在谈到您实际需要的 CSS 时可能会非常混乱,我看到有些人宁愿只包含所有内容。

如果我下载了 jQuery UI:

  1. 我需要包含哪些 CSS?
  2. 哪个是哪个?

【问题讨论】:

    标签: jquery jquery-ui jquery-plugins


    【解决方案1】:

    包含所有 CSS 都可以,但这是错误的方法...
    此答案与 jQuery UI 的当前最新稳定版本有关:1.11.4。

    你需要什么 CSS

    这取决于您希望如何构建/拆分 CSS 逻辑,以及您是要使用
    完整包还是仅使用部分组件。

    使用全包

    只有一个 CSS:

    只包含jquery-ui CSS 的生产版本

    快速回答:jquery-ui.min.css

    此文件同时包含:
    - 结构(让 jQuery UI 正常工作)
    - 主题 CSS(让 jQuery UI 看起来更好:))。

    独立的结构和风格

    不要包含jquery-ui CSS!
    为结构和主题包括单独的(生产)文件,例如:
    jquery-ui.structure.min.cssjquery-ui.theme.min.css - 按此顺序!

    如果您根本不想包含主题,只需包含jquery-ui.structure 的生产版本...


    仅使用某些部分

    如果您担心性能/负载,您可能只选择了 jQuery UI 的某些部分,很可能您可以通过以下方式之一来完成...

    下载生成器

    如果您已经通过Download Builder 准备了您的 jQuery UI 文件,则说明与 使用完整包 的说明相同(见上文)。

    核心与组件

    如果您已下载核心和组件,请首先包含核心 CSS 的生产版本,例如:
    core.min.css
    然后以 顺序 包含其他 CSS,依赖项位于依赖项之前
    作为最后,包括主题的生产 CSS。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2015-11-30
      相关资源
      最近更新 更多